How much do rest api testing j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 20, 2026, the average hourly pay for rest api testing in California is $48.78,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$32.74 and $62.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is Rest API testing?

A REST API Testing job involves verifying the functionality, reliability, performance, and security of RESTful web services. Testers use tools like Postman, REST Assured, or JMeter to send requests, validate responses, and ensure API endpoints behave as expected. Responsibilities include writing test cases, automating API tests, identifying issues, and working closely with developers to resolve defects. This role is crucial for ensuring seamless integration between front-end and back-end systems in software applications.

What does a typical day look like for someone working in Rest API testing?

A typical day in Rest API Testing involves designing and executing test cases for various endpoints, validating responses against both functional and non-functional requirements, and documenting any issues or defects discovered. Testers often collaborate closely with developers, QA engineers, and product managers to clarify requirements and ensure comprehensive coverage. Additionally, they may participate in daily stand-ups or agile ceremonies, contribute to test automation efforts, and help maintain test documentation. This collaborative and detail-oriented environment provides opportunities to improve technical skills and play a key role in delivering high-quality software.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Rest API testing position, and why are they important?

To thrive in Rest API Testing, you need a solid understanding of software testing principles, API protocols (such as REST and HTTP methods), and the ability to create and execute test cases. Familiarity with tools like Postman, SoapUI, and automated testing frameworks, as well as relevant certifications such as ISTQB, are often required.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help testers document defects clearly and collaborate with development teams. These competencies are crucial for ensuring the performance, reliability, and security of API services in modern software applications.
